Double-Opening Card

Hand Stamped Cards· Stamping Tips· Video Series - Creative Folds

6 Oct

Double-Opening Card Creative Fold Linda Bauwin

Today's creative fold video features a double-opening card.  This card design was shared with me by Leigh Amburgey of Mentor.  It uses the very poplar Happy Scenes Stamp Set, and the Happy Haunting Designer Paper.

This creative fold is very simple to make.  You are just making two cards with one being a 1/4" of an inch smaller.  So your card sizes are simply 5 1/2" x 8 1/2", and the inside is 5 1/4" x 8".

Double-Opening Card Linda Bauwin

As you will see in the video, the small size card is the inside and the fold is on the right hand side, instead of the left.  The only hard part of this card, is making sure you mask the front so that whatever your stamp image is that it will show through the window.
